An open API service indexing awesome lists of open source software.

https://github.com/modoboa/modoboa

Mail hosting made simple
https://github.com/modoboa/modoboa

django dovecot email hosting javascript modoboa postfix python3 rspamd vuejs vuejs3 vuetify

Last synced: 2 days ago
JSON representation

Mail hosting made simple

Awesome Lists containing this project

README

          

############################################
Modoboa (`website `_)
############################################

|workflow| |codecov| |latest-version| |deepwiki|

`Modoboa `_ is a mail hosting and management platform including a modern
and simplified Web User Interface. It provides useful components such
as an administration panel and webmail.

Modoboa integrates with well known software such as `Postfix
`_ or `Dovecot `_. A SQL
database (`MySQL `_, `PostgreSQL
`_ or `SQLite `_)
is used as a central point of communication between all components.

Modoboa is developed with modularity in mind, expanding it is really
easy. Actually, all current features are extensions.

It is written in Python 3 and uses the `Django
`_ and `Vue `_
frameworks.

*************
Main features
*************

* Administration panel
* Reputation protection: `DNSBL `_ checks, `DMARC `_ `reports `_ and more
* `Amavis `_ `frontend `_
* Webmail
* Calendar
* Address book
* Per-user Sieve filters
* Autoreply messages
* Graphical statistics about email traffic

************
Installation
************

The easiest way to install modoboa is to use the
`official installer `_.
More information is available in the documentation.

*************
Documentation
*************

A detailed `documentation `_ will help you
to install, use or extend Modoboa.

*****************
Demo Installation
*****************

If you want to try out Modoboa, check out our `demo installation `_.

************
Getting help
************

Modoboa is a free software and is totally open source BUT you can hire the team if you need professional services. More information here: https://modoboa.org/en/professional-services/.

Contracting a support plan is a good way to ensure your installation stays available and up-to-date and it will help the project to be sustainable :)

*********
Community
*********

If you have any questions, you can get help through the following platforms:

* `Discord `_
* Github: open an issue if you found a bug

.. |latest-version| image:: https://img.shields.io/pypi/v/modoboa.svg
:target: https://pypi.python.org/pypi/modoboa/
:alt: Latest version on Pypi
.. |workflow| image:: https://github.com/modoboa/modoboa/actions/workflows/modoboa.yml/badge.svg
.. |codecov| image:: https://codecov.io/gh/modoboa/modoboa/graph/badge.svg?token=1E5eBxJO33
:target: https://codecov.io/gh/modoboa/modoboa
.. |deepwiki| image:: https://deepwiki.com/badge.svg
:target: https://deepwiki.com/modoboa/modoboa